怎么给二维数组输入内容

作者&投稿:兀有龚 (若有异议请与网页底部的电邮联系)

一维数组怎样赋值给二维数组
程序是我调试完发出来的... 图不知道为什么发不上去... 这个应该就是按你说的了 已知 一个一维数组里面按顺序的10个数... 然后输入个数 循环遍历比较输入的数和数组中的数 若相同,输出数组下标,循环终止,若一直到最后都没找到有相同的,则输出 数组中不存在该数 ......

二维数组所有元素的输入必须用循环结构吗
由于需要顺序控制下标取值,因此用循环(有其使用for循环)语句比较合适。当然可以采用其他方式输入,比如在数组元素少的情况下,可以逐一写出确定的下标来输入。

急急!!!如何用c语言输入和输出一个二维数组??
include <stdio.h> include <stdlib.h> int main(){ int a[2][2];int i,j;for (i=0;i<2;i++){ for (j=0;j<2;j++){ scanf("%d ",&a[i][j]);} } for(i=0;i<2;i++)for(j=0;j<2;j++)printf("%d",a[i][j]);return 0;} 运行成功 ...

labview中如何给二维数组赋值
2、打开后面板,找到对应的数组。然后右键菜单中点击属性。3、默认的数组的属性为1维的,我们将其改为2。4、再次回到前面板,在数值库中,将数值插入控件拖入二维数组中的灰色区域。5、此时前面板中,数组的形状发生了变化。6、此时点住鼠标左键,拉住刚才的数值输入控件往下,形成1列。7、紧接着,...

二维数组所有元素的输入必须用循环结构吗?
1)大大简化代码。设想,如果有100个、1000个元素需要输入,不用循环的话,那代码长度就非常可观,还有可能会有代码写错的地方,就更麻烦了。2)可以根据情况的变化,更改循环体执行的次数,这一点来说,不使用循环就更麻烦了。需要使用if判断语句来决定,要不要执行本行的输入语句。所以,二维数组所有...

定义一个 char类型的二维数组 怎么分行输入数据 要是敲回车的话 回车不...
用%c读入字符的时候,空格和回车都默认被当作分隔符。例如我定义了一个二维数组char c[2][2]可以这样来读入:for(int i = 0;i < 2;i++)for(int j = 0;j < 2;j++)scanf("%c",&c[i][j]);你输入的时候可以直接在一行输入,像这样:a b c d 也可心用回车来分隔,像这样:a b c...

在vb中如何输入快速输入二维数组
从文本中按行读取内容你会的话 应该不会有问题的 Open FilePath For Input AS #1 ‘打开文本文件,FilePath为你的文本路径 For i = 0 to iMax - 1 Line Input #1,strLine strNums = Split(strline, ‘\\t’) ‘这里\\t为你在文本中的分隔符,我用制表符当示例 For j = 0 to jMax -...

C++二维数组的输入和输出
include<stdio.h> include<stdlib.h> int main(){ int m,n,i,j;int **x;scanf("%d%d",&m,&n);x=(int **)malloc(sizeof(int *)*m);for(i=0;i<m;i++){ x[i]=(int *)malloc(sizeof(int)*n);} for(i=0;i<m;i++){ for(j=0;j<n;j++){ scanf("%d",&x[i]...

c++中用for循环对二维数组赋值可以吗,就是自己手动输入数据
当然可以啦 例如 include <iostream> using namespace std;void main(){ int a[3][3];for(int i=0;i<3;i++)for(int j=0;j<3;j++)cin>>a[i][j];} 我的编程代码文章分享博客 blog.163.c om\/vince_n\/ blog.sina. c om.c n\/zhengyuhong520 hi.baidu.com\/zhengyuhong520 我的...

二维数组输入
\/\/vc6下编译,运行成功,并达到题目效果 \/\/程序如下:include<stdio.h>int main(){ int i,j;\/\/用于for循环 int num,searchn;\/\/num输入的数字,searchn表示需要查找的学号 int student[8][7];\/\/根据题目使用二维数组,共8名学生,7(表示的是1个学号+6个成绩) \/\/输入8个学生的成绩,...

伊农18837227352问: 请教二维数组如何输入啊? -
化德县珍母回答: 运行程序,输入整数,可以 1 回车 2 回车 3 回车 或 1 2 3 4 5 回车 6 回车 7 8 回车 也就是说,可以一个数据输入后按回车,或输入很多数据彼此间用空格分隔再按回车.主要原因是C采用缓冲输入输出流

伊农18837227352问: C语言如何将数据放入二维数组 -
化德县珍母回答: 我给你个动态分配二维数组的函数,访问二维数组就看范例的应用吧.#include "stdio.h" #include "conio.h" #include "stdlib.h"int **AllocIntArray(int row,int col) {int i,j;int **pArray;pArray=(int **)malloc(row*sizeof(int *));if(pArray==...

伊农18837227352问: C语言中从屏幕上给一个二位数组输值的程序怎么写 -
化德县珍母回答: 对二维数组输值,需要对二维数组每个元素进行遍历,并逐个输入每个元素的值.如对一个4行5列的二维数组输值,可以写作:12345 inta[4][5]; inti,j; for(i = 0; i < 4; i ++) for(j = 0; j < 5; j ++) scanf("%d",&a[i][j]);

伊农18837227352问: 怎样输入二维数组? -
化德县珍母回答: 看看这个吧,在窗体上放一个命令按钮command1和一个文本框text1还有个MSFlexGrid 控件grid1 思路是这样的用grid1的每个单元格代表数组的元素,在单元格中输入数据,最后点保存判断每个单元格是否为空,如果不为空则把它的值保存到对...

伊农18837227352问: c语言二维数组输入 -
化德县珍母回答: 输入格式里不要添加空格(你用了: "%d ") .改用 scanf("%d", &a[j][i]); 就可以了.输入的数据 用空格 或 换行符分隔即可.

伊农18837227352问: 急急!!!如何用c语言输入和输出一个二维数组?? -
化德县珍母回答: 我就简单定义一个2行3列的数组 #include void main() { int i,j,a[2][3]; printf("请输入数组数据:"); for(i=0;i

伊农18837227352问: 如何将以下数据输入一个二维数组 -
化德县珍母回答: 你应该是问的如何将数组输出成那个样子吧...关键部分.int x;//用来判断是否该换行 for(int i=0;i<5;i++)//先输出列!!这个是重点...弄反了就反了 for(int j=0;j<3;j++) { if(5==x)//判断一行有了5个元素了 { cout<<endl;//换行 } cout<<a[i][j]<<" "; x++; } 这样,就OK了

伊农18837227352问: C语言如何用函数输入输出二维数组 -
化德县珍母回答: #include <stdio.h>int a[10][10];int main() {int i , j; //input datafor( i = 0; i < 10; i++)//多少行{for(j = 0; j < 10; j++)//多少列{scanf("%d", &a[i][j]);//输入第i行j列的值}}//ouput datafor( i = 0; i < 10; i++){for(j = 0; j < 10; j++){printf("%d ",a[i][j]);}}return 0; }

伊农18837227352问: C语言,二维数组输入输出 -
化德县珍母回答: 2维数组可以按一维排列 a[j][i] 对应 a[j*n+i] #include main() { int i,j,n,m; int *a, *b; static int v; scanf("%d %d",&n,&m); a = (int*)malloc(sizeof(int)*n*m); b = (int*)malloc(sizeof(int)*n*m); for (j=0;jfor (i=0;i{ scanf("%d",&v); a[j*m+i]=v; b[i*n+j]=v;} for (j=0;jfor (j=0;j}

伊农18837227352问: C++怎么用cin输入二维字符数组? -
化德县珍母回答: 两种方法可以使用: 定义二维数组char a[10][100]; 1,输入字符串方式. 如果二维数组的每一行均为字符串,那么可以采用cin>>a[n]的形式输入,每次输入为数组的一行. 2,输入字符方式. 如果要存储的并不是字符串,而是可能包含空白字符...


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网